Manual Override; Escribir Una Entrada Del Usuario En El Controlador - Siemens S7 Serie Manual De Sistema

Controlador programable
Ocultar thumbs Ver también para S7 Serie:
Tabla de contenido

Publicidad

Servidor web
11.6 Páginas web definidas por el usuario
<!-- AWP_In_Variable
Name='"Bloque_de_datos_1".HabilitarCorrecciónManual'
Enum="EstadoCorrección" -->
<!-- AWP_Enum_Def Name="OverrideStatus" Values='0:"Off",1:"On"' -->
Donde la página HTML incluye un campo de visualización en una celda de la tabla para el
estado actual de HabilitarCorrecciónManual, se utiliza solamente un comando normal de
lectura de variables, pero utilizando el tipo de enumeración referenciado y declarado
anteriormente, la página muestra "Off" o "On" en lugar de 0 o 1.
<td style="width:24%; border-top-style: Solid; border-top-width:
2px; border-top-color: #ffffff;">
<p>Manual override:
:="Bloque_de_datos_1".HabilitarCorrecciónManual:</p>
</td>
La página HTML incluye una lista de selección desplegable para que el usuario modifique el
valor de HabilitarCorrecciónManual. La lista de selección utiliza el texto "Sí" y "No" para
visualizarlo en las listas de selección. Al utilizar el tipo de enumeración, "Sí" se correlaciona
con el valor "On" del tipo de enumeración y "No" se correlaciona con el valor "Off". Una
selección vacía deja el valor de HabilitarCorrecciónManual inalterado.
<select name='"Bloque_de_datos_1".HabilitarCorrecciónManual'>
<option value=':"Bloque_de_datos_1".HabilitarCorrecciónManual:'>
</option>
<option value="On">Sí</option>
<option selected value="Off">No</option>
</select>
La lista de selección está incluida dentro de un diálogo en la página HTML. Si el usuario
hace clic en el botón de envío, la página envía el diálogo que escribe un valor de "1" en el
booleano de HabilitarCorrecciónManual en Bloque_de_datos_1 en caso de que el usuario
haya seleccionado "Si", o bien "0" si el usuario ha seleccionado "No".
11.6.8.4

Escribir una entrada del usuario en el controlador

La página HTML de vigilancia remota de la turbina de viento dispone de varios comandos
AWP para escribir datos en el controlador (Página 651). La página HTML declara
AWP_In_Variables para variables booleanas, de modo que un usuario con privilegios para
modificar variables pueda conmutar la turbina de viento a control manual y activar la
corrección manual para la velocidad de la turbina, la corrección de viraje o la corrección de
cabeceo de hojas. Esta página también utiliza AWP_In_Variables para permitir a un usuario
con privilegios para modificar variables especificar posteriormente valores en coma flotante
para la velocidad, el viraje y el cabeceo de la turbina, así como para el porcentaje de
frenado. La página utiliza un comando de envío de diálogos HTTP para escribir las
AWP_In_Variables en el controlador.
Por ejemplo, tenga en cuenta el código HTML para ajustar manualmente el valor de frenado:
672
Controlador programable S7-1200
Manual de sistema, 03/2014, A5E02486683-AG

Publicidad

Tabla de contenido
loading

Este manual también es adecuado para:

S7-1200

Tabla de contenido